What counts as “walkable” here
I only include airports where all three are true:
- the route is legal and obvious (no sketchy shoulder walking)
- the walk reaches a useful zone (station district, hotel cluster, or center edge)
- the savings are meaningful versus transfer time/cost
Best current picks
Pisa (PSA), Italy
- Typical walk: 15–25 min to Pisa Centrale side
- Works best when: you sleep first night near station/river corridor
- Don’t walk if: your stay is near Piazza dei Miracoli with a heavy bag
Gibraltar (GIB)
- Typical walk: 15–30 min depending on crossing/queue timing
- Works best when: daytime arrival, carry-on, no weather issues
- Don’t walk if: queues spike, rain hits, or you have mobility constraints

Corfu (CFU), Greece
- Typical walk: 30–40 min toward Corfu Town edge
- Works best when: shoulder season + light pack
- Don’t walk if: peak heat or late-night landing
London City (LCY), UK (specific use case)
- Typical walk: short only for nearby Docklands stays
- Works best when: your hotel is already in the airport-adjacent zone
- Don’t walk if: your destination is central London
Where airport walks fail in real life
Most bad experiences come from predictable issues:
- overpacked bag turning 20 minutes into 45+
- wrong first-night location (old town uphill, not station-side)
- late arrival when navigation confidence drops
- weather blind spot (wind/rain/heat)
If two of those apply, transit is usually the better call.
20-second arrival decision test
Walk only if at least 3 of 4 are true:
- Your bag is truly light (about ≤8–10 kg)
- It’s daylight, or you already know the route
- Weather is reasonable for a 15–40 min walk
- Savings are meaningful (money or time)
If not, take transit and protect your energy for the trip itself.
Booking pattern that works
For short trips, book first night in the airport-to-center corridor (often station-side districts):
- lower stress if flights slip
- better value than tourist core
- easier next-morning move into sights
